Role Responsibilities

Calculate gross, net, and pro‑forma IRRs, TWRs, multiples, and other performance and financial statistics and ratios.

Maintain, own, and prepare attribution reports, investor reports, performance metrics reports, and track records.

Engage directly with senior leadership, capital formation, and deal teams to produce and deliver valuable insights.

Develop and enhance data extracts and report templates to accurately and efficiently aggregate data for investment and fund analysis.

Conduct ad‑hoc and pro‑forma analytics at the investment, portfolio, and fund levels as needed.

Assist with special projects to standardize and enrich data across the platform.

Monitor investment and fund activity to ensure accurate reporting.

Model fund and strategy returns with pro‑forma and sensitivity analyses for deal teams and senior management.
